Semi-finalists confirmed for Digicel Escott Shield competition

Semi-finalists confirmed for Digicel Escott Shield competition

By Navitalai Naivalurua
24/10/2020
[Photo: Suva Rugby]

Police Blue, RKS Old Boys, Covenant Brothers and Freshet Navy Blue have secured their places in the semifinals of the Digicel Escott Shield competition.

Freshet Navy Blue beat Nabua Maroons 21-3 this afternoon.

Meanwhile, Eastern Saints will face Freshet Navy White in the final of the Digicel Koroturaga competition.

Eastern Saints defeated Lomaiviti Black 28-21 in the second semi-final this afternoon at Suva Grammar School Ground.

Freshet Navy White defeated Kalekana Rugby 18-17 in the first semifinal.

Digicel Koroturaga Cup Qtr Finals - Eastern Saints 13 - 5 West Coast Drifters - Lomai Black 20 - 15 Navakavu 1 - DHL Raiwaqa 14 - 17 Freshet Navy White - Kalekana 13 - 8 Wainibuka Cavaliers

Digicel Escott Shield Quarter Finals - Police Blue 39 - 29 Fire Wardens - Army Green 12 - 17 RKSOB - Covenant Bros 25 - 3 QVSOB
